The TX230-TB-300 is tuned for 210–260MHz (center 230MHz) and must be paired with a wireless module operating in this VHF band. Using it with a 433MHz or 915MHz module will result in severe impedance mismatch, high VSWR, and significantly reduced communication range. Always verify your module's operating frequency before selecting an antenna.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003cdiv style=\"margin-bottom: 20px; padding: 15px; background: #fafafa; border-radius: 8px;\"\u003e\n      \u003cp style=\"font-weight: bold; margin-bottom: 6px;\"\u003eQ: Can the antenna be mounted on a non-metallic surface?\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003cp style=\"color: #555; margin: 0; font-size: 14px;\"\u003eA: The magnetic base requires a ferromagnetic metal surface to adhere and to function as a ground plane. Mounting on plastic, wood, or fiberglass will prevent the base from holding and will degrade radiation performance, potentially reducing gain by 2–3 dBi. For non-metallic surfaces, a separate metal ground plane sheet (minimum 200 × 200mm) placed under the base is recommended.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003cdiv style=\"margin-bottom: 20px; padding: 15px; background: #fafafa; border-radius: 8px;\"\u003e\n      \u003cp style=\"font-weight: bold; margin-bottom: 6px;\"\u003eQ: What is the SMA-J connector standard and is it compatible with my device?\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003cp style=\"color: #555; margin: 0; font-size: 14px;\"\u003eA: SMA-J (also written SMA Male or SMA-plug) has an inner pin and outer thread. It mates with SMA-K (SMA Female \/ SMA-jack) ports found on most industrial wireless modules, routers, and APs. Confirm your device has an SMA-K (female) port before ordering. SMA and RP-SMA connectors are not interchangeable — RP-SMA reverses the pin\/socket arrangement.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003cdiv style=\"margin-bottom: 20px; padding: 15px; background: #fafafa; border-radius: 8px;\"\u003e\n      \u003cp style=\"font-weight: bold; margin-bottom: 6px;\"\u003eQ: What is the operating temperature range and is the cable suitable for outdoor use?\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003cp style=\"color: #555; margin: 0; font-size: 14px;\"\u003eA: The TX230-TB-300 is rated for -40°C to +85°C. In open rural, agricultural, and low-obstacle environments, 230MHz antennas can achieve 20–40% greater effective range than 433MHz antennas at equivalent power levels. This makes the TX230-TB-300 particularly suitable for wide-area IoT deployments where obstacle penetration and long-range coverage are priorities.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003c\/div\u003e\n  \u003c\/section\u003e\n\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"cdsenet","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":45301875474534,"sku":"tx230-tb-300","price":10.16,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0702\/9918\/9350\/files\/TX230-TB-300-_1_800x800_v2.jpg?v=1773986648","url":"https:\/\/cdsenet.store\/products\/tx230-tb-300-230mhz-vhf-magnetic-antenna-5-0dbi-sma","provider":"CDSENET, Built for the Wireless World","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
